From Hardware to Software: What's Really Changing?
The term "software-defined car" could appear futuristic, yet possibilities are you've already seen one at work. These automobiles rely greatly on incorporated software application systems to manage every little thing from amusement to steering. Instead of separated electronic control units taking care of tasks independently, software-defined autos utilize centralized calculating to manage the automobile holistically. That shift brings massive comfort, but additionally new obligations for owners and professionals.
Unlike conventional lorries, where wear and tear is very easy to detect and identify, software-defined autos typically save performance data, mistake codes, and system wellness reports deep within internal digital systems. This suggests diagnostics currently require customized tools and software proficiency. An auto mechanic can not count only on noise, odor, or vibration-- they likewise require to read the information.

Updates Over the Air-- and Under the Radar
One of one of the most revolutionary changes brought by software-defined automobiles is the concept of over-the-air updates. These updates can modify engine efficiency, add safety attributes, or take care of pests, much like a smart device. What once needed a journey to a shop now takes place silently while your cars and truck beings in the driveway.
But this comfort has compromises. Proprietors have to stay alert to upgrade alerts, equally as they would for a phone or computer. Neglecting them can lead to issues in the future, specifically when efficiency, safety and security, or connectivity is at stake.
